Goldstein coverHebrew Poems from Spain
Introduction, Translation and Notes by David GoldsteinPrint on Demand logo
Forward by Raymond Scheindlin

Author Information - Publication Details - Contents

read more about this bookThe poems of the Golden Age of Spanish Jewry (950-1200) offer a vivid representation of contemporary Jewish life as well as a deep consciousness of Israel’s relationship with God and an intense concern with the fate of the Jewish people. This volume conveys the greatness of that literature through the work of thirteen poets.

AUTHOR INFORMATION

David Goldstein was Curator of Hebrew Books and Manuscripts at the British Library.  His translation of The Wisdom of the Zohar, also published by the Littman Library, was awarded the Webber Prize in 1987.

Raymond Scheindlin is Professor of Medieval Hebrew Literature at the Jewish Theological Seminary in New York.
